Bumps botocore from 1.29.40 to 1.34.50.

Changelog

Sourced from botocore's changelog.

1.34.50

  • api-change:apigateway: Documentation updates for Amazon API Gateway.
  • api-change:drs: Added volume status to DescribeSourceServer replicated volumes.
  • api-change:kafkaconnect: Adds support for tagging, with new TagResource, UntagResource and ListTagsForResource APIs to manage tags and updates to existing APIs to allow tag on create. This release also adds support for the new DeleteWorkerConfiguration API.
  • api-change:rds: This release adds support for gp3 data volumes for Multi-AZ DB Clusters.

1.34.49

  • api-change:appsync: Documentation only updates for AppSync
  • api-change:qldb: Clarify possible values for KmsKeyArn and EncryptionDescription.
  • api-change:rds: Add pattern and length based validations for DBShardGroupIdentifier
  • api-change:rum: Doc-only update for new RUM metrics that were added

1.34.48

  • api-change:internetmonitor: This release adds IPv4 prefixes to health events
  • api-change:kinesisvideo: Increasing NextToken parameter length restriction for List APIs from 512 to 1024.

1.34.47

  • api-change:iotevents: Increase the maximum length of descriptions for Inputs, Detector Models, and Alarm Models
  • api-change:lookoutequipment: This release adds a field exposing model quality to read APIs for models. It also adds a model quality field to the API response when creating an inference scheduler.
  • api-change:medialive: MediaLive now supports the ability to restart pipelines in a running channel.
  • api-change:ssm: This release adds support for sharing Systems Manager parameters with other AWS accounts.

1.34.46

  • api-change:dynamodb: Publishing quick fix for doc only update.
  • api-change:firehose: This release updates a few Firehose related APIs.
  • api-change:lambda: Add .NET 8 (dotnet8) Runtime support to AWS Lambda.

1.34.45

  • api-change:amplify: This release contains API changes that enable users to configure their Amplify domains with their own custom SSL/TLS certificate.
  • api-change:chatbot: This release adds support for AWS Chatbot. You can now monitor, operate, and troubleshoot your AWS resources with interactive ChatOps using the AWS SDK.
  • api-change:config: Documentation updates for the AWS Config CLI
  • api-change:ivs: Changed description for latencyMode in Create/UpdateChannel and Channel/ChannelSummary.
  • api-change:keyspaces: Documentation updates for Amazon Keyspaces
